Here's another addition to 70's sitcoms that go to Hawaii- Green Acres 1971 titled Hawaiian Honeymoon where the Oliver and Lisa go on a 5th honeymoon. Most I suspect was filmed on a soundstage but it still works. It's on Hulu now see it while you can. Nice touches on the plane seats on the Hawaiian flight. A haunting serenade in the lobby by rockin sounds of The Three Coconuts. Arriving with a Tiki Room Sign in the background. The front desk with tiki prop. Breakfast in the Tiki Room with Pat Morita as the waiter. |

What could be cooler 1960's Pop Art than Batman and Tiki ?? In the 1966 first episode of the TV series, Batman visits the "What a Way to Go-Go" nightclub which had both Tiki torches and 2 large Tikis outside...
This episode was also significant for guest star (and future Bond girl) Jill St. John as well as introducing the Batusi dance craze. :)

There's an episode of the Bob Newhart show in which Carol's husband opens a travel agency in Bob's office building (yes, a medical building.) To promote the new agency, they decked out the whole lobby as a repica Hawaiian paradise, complete with a couple large Tikis. Season 5, Epidode 22, "The Mentor." Then the other day I caught part of a Dragnet epidode in which they were investigating a scam involving a fake police organization that was giving out membership cards to business owners that donated. One of the businesses who filed a complaint was a Polynesian/Tiki style bar. I didn't spot any actual Tikis, but I didn't see the entire scene. Season 2, Episode 13, "The Phony Police Racket." |

Making Monsters is a show on the Travel Channel about Ed Edmunds and his company, Distortions Unlimited, who create some of the scariest animatronics and “frightronics” the haunt industry has ever seen. In an episode called "Evil Tiki" they head to Hawaii where a local company has asked them to create, build and install an evil tiki statue in their entryway. I live a block away from the Dexter and Rita house. It's in an area of Long Beach, CA called Bluff Park. One day my girlfriend saw John Lithgow quickly walking around the block which she thought was cool. Lots of 'Dexter' is filmed in Long Beach. 'CSI Miami' did quite a bit of filming here too. Dexter does some filming at Alfredo's Kayak Kafe and it has tiki's sitting on the sand. I'll try to take some pics this weekend. |
